用戶:使用操作系統(tǒng)的人
用戶組:具有相同權(quán)限的一組用戶
/etc/group :存儲(chǔ)當(dāng)前系統(tǒng)中所有用戶組的信息
--Group%20:x:%20123%20:%20abc,def,xyz
--組名稱:組密碼占位符:組編號(hào):組中用戶名列表
/etc/gshadow:存儲(chǔ)當(dāng)前系統(tǒng)中用戶組的密碼信息
--Group:%20*:%20:%20abc,def,xyz
--組名稱:組密碼:組管理者:組中用戶名列表
注:*!表示組密碼為空;
/etc/passwd存儲(chǔ)當(dāng)前系統(tǒng)中所有用戶的信息
--user:%20x%20:%20123%20:456:%20xxxxxxxx:/home/user%20:%20/bin/bash
--用戶名:密碼占位符:用戶編號(hào):用戶注釋信息:用戶主目錄:shell類型
/etc/shadow存儲(chǔ)當(dāng)前系統(tǒng)中所有用戶的密碼信息
--user%20:%20vf;/Zu8sdf…%20:::::
--用戶名:密碼:::::
創(chuàng)建一個(gè)用戶組:groupadd sexy#創(chuàng)建了一個(gè)名字為sexy的用戶組;
改變用戶組名:groupmod –n market sexy#新組名在前,舊組名在后;
改變用戶組編號(hào):groupmod –g 668 market# 把用戶組market的組名改為668;
useradd -g mysql mysql -s /bin/false #創(chuàng)建用戶mysql并加入到mysql組,不允許mysql用戶直接登錄系統(tǒng)。沒個(gè)用戶創(chuàng)建時(shí)都會(huì)創(chuàng)建一個(gè)與用戶名相同的組linux命令大全,這個(gè)組就是這個(gè)用戶的主組,一個(gè)用戶最多有31個(gè)附屬組。指導(dǎo)教師評(píng)語(yǔ):指導(dǎo)教師 簽字 : 年 月 日課程設(shè)計(jì)成績(jī) i2西安交通大學(xué)課程設(shè)計(jì)報(bào)告 用戶輸入數(shù)據(jù)random 函數(shù)模塊來隨機(jī)產(chǎn)生參與者的密碼,并且存儲(chǔ)、處理這些數(shù)據(jù),之后輸出它們exit 0 函數(shù)負(fù)責(zé)終止程序運(yùn)行solid 函數(shù)模塊來提示用戶輸入密碼并且存儲(chǔ)、處理這些數(shù)據(jù),之后輸出結(jié)果根據(jù)程序啟動(dòng)時(shí)用戶所選的數(shù)字選項(xiàng),main 函數(shù)來調(diào)用相應(yīng)的子函數(shù)模塊 開始輸入第一個(gè)報(bào)的數(shù)key及系統(tǒng)隨機(jī)產(chǎn)生各個(gè)參與者的密碼n 0 報(bào)數(shù)過程輸出出列者的編號(hào)及密碼 結(jié)束 n-- 開始用戶輸入各個(gè)參與者的密碼及第一個(gè)要報(bào)的數(shù)keyn 0 報(bào)數(shù)過程輸出出列者的編號(hào)及密碼 n-- 結(jié)束 開始輸入總?cè)藬?shù)n創(chuàng)建并初始化n個(gè)節(jié)點(diǎn)輸入第一個(gè)要報(bào)的數(shù)keyn 0 報(bào)數(shù)過程輸出出列者的編號(hào)及密碼 結(jié)束 n--。
刪除用戶組:groupdel market#刪除了用戶組maket;(刪除用戶組之前需要先刪除用戶linux命令大全,否則在這個(gè)用戶組中的用戶的配置文件會(huì)出錯(cuò),權(quán)限的影響)
往用戶組中添加用戶:groupadd –g sexy sdf#向用戶組sexy中添加用戶sdf;
創(chuàng)建用戶的同時(shí),指定用戶的個(gè)人文件夾:useradd –d /home/xxx imooc
給用戶添加備注:usermod –c 備注信息 用戶名
改變用戶名:usermod –l 新的用戶名 舊的用戶名
給用戶指定新的問價(jià)夾:usermod –d /home/文件夾 用戶名
用戶切換用戶組:usermod –g 用戶組名用戶名
刪除用戶: userdl 用戶名(不刪除個(gè)人文件夾)
刪除用戶同時(shí)刪除用戶文件夾:userdel –r用戶名
禁止普通用戶登錄服務(wù)器:在/etc/下創(chuàng)建nologin文件:touch /etc/nologin
鎖定賬戶操作:password –l用戶名
解鎖賬戶:password –u 用戶名
設(shè)置無密碼登錄賬戶:password –d用戶名
給用戶添加附屬組:gpasswd –a用戶名附屬組名(添加多個(gè)附屬組用“,”隔開)
切換到附屬組:newgrp用戶組
取消附屬組:gpasswd –d 用戶名附屬組
創(chuàng)建用戶是指定他的主要組和附屬組:useradd –g主要組名稱 –G 附屬組名稱
給用戶組設(shè)主密碼:gpasswd 用戶組名
切換用戶:su 用戶名
Whoami#顯示當(dāng)前登錄用戶名
id 用戶名#顯示指定用戶信息,包括用戶編號(hào),用戶名,主要組編號(hào)及名稱,附屬組表;
groups 用戶名#顯示用戶所在的所有組
chfn 用戶名#設(shè)置用戶資料,依次輸入用戶資料
finger用戶名#顯示用戶詳細(xì)資料